Automobile luggage rack end drilling tool
Technical Field
The utility model relates to the technical field of automobile part machining, in particular to an automobile luggage rack end drilling tool.
Background
Tooling, namely process equipment: the automobile luggage rack is a general name of various tools used in the manufacturing process, tools are general short for the automobile luggage rack, the automobile luggage rack has aesthetic and practical functions, and can bear objects which cannot be placed in a luggage compartment, for example, bulky luggage, bicycles, folding beds and the like, so long as a car owner fixes the goods in place, and more objects can be carried particularly when an ascending luggage rope net is additionally arranged on the goods. The automobile luggage rack often needs to be drilled due to installation requirements or use requirements, and drilling of the end part is difficult to operate and needs to be assisted and fixed by a clamping tool.
Most of the clamping devices in the prior market only clamp from two opposite surfaces, are difficult to be applied to clamping the end part of the luggage rack in a targeted way, and are difficult to flexibly support and assist the drilling operation of the end part of the automobile luggage rack.

Detailed Description
The present invention will be described in further detail with reference to specific examples, but the embodiments of the present invention are not limited thereto.
Referring to fig. 1-2, an automobile luggage rack end drilling tool comprises a support sleeve 1, wherein a limiting through groove 2 is formed in the top wall and the bottom wall of the support sleeve 1 in a penetrating manner, a limiting slip sheet 3 is connected inside the limiting through groove 2 in a sliding manner, a sliding bush 4 is fixedly installed on one side, located inside the support sleeve 1, of the limiting slip sheet 3, an internal threaded pipe 5 is fixedly inserted and installed in the middle of the side wall of the sliding bush 4, a threaded rotating shaft 6 is connected to the internal thread of the internal threaded pipe 5 in a threaded manner, a first bearing 7 is sleeved at one end of the threaded rotating shaft 6, the end of the threaded rotating shaft 6 is rotatably connected with the middle of the side wall of the support sleeve 1 through the first bearing 7, a second bearing 8 is sleeved on the surface of the threaded rotating shaft 6, the surface of the threaded rotating shaft 6 is connected with the middle of the side wall of the support sleeve 1 in a penetrating manner and rotating manner through the second bearing 8, and a handheld rotating column 9 is fixedly installed at one end, located outside the support sleeve 1, of the threaded rotating shaft 6, spacing gleitbretter 3 is located one side fixed mounting of 1 outside of support cover has centre gripping support arm 11, and the middle part that the handheld rotary column 9 side was kept away from to support cover 1 bonds and has tip bearing pad 10, and the fixed surface of centre gripping support arm 11 installs supporting spring 12, and the tip fixed mounting of supporting spring 12 has centre gripping clamp plate 13, and the one side that supporting spring 12 was kept away from to centre gripping clamp plate 13 bonds and has centre gripping touch pad 14, and damping recess 15 has been seted up on the surface of centre gripping touch pad 14.
According to the utility model, the clamping press plates 13 are pulled to clamp the end parts of the frame body to be processed through the clamping contact pads 14, the clamping contact pads 14 are clamped more tightly through the damping grooves 15, and then the hand-held rotary columns 9 are twisted to drive the threaded rotary shafts 6 to rotate, so that the internal threaded pipes 5 transversely move on the surface of the internal threaded pipes, the sliding bushes 4 and the limiting sliding sheets 3 are driven to slide, the two clamping support arms 11 are pushed or pulled to move, the clamped end parts of the frame body can be squeezed against the end part bearing pads 10 on the side walls of the support sleeve 1, the effect of enabling the clamped workpiece to bear force in multiple directions is achieved, the aim of supporting the end parts of the clamping frame body is achieved, the drilling operation for the end parts of the structure is facilitated, and stable support is provided for the clamping frame body.
In the utility model, a pulling button piece 16 is fixedly arranged on the surface of the clamping pressure plate 13, and a pulling convex pattern 17 is arranged on the surface of the pulling button piece 16. The clamping pressing plate 13 is convenient to stir to pull open the clamping pressing plate 13 during operation by pulling the button piece 16 on the surface of the clamping pressing plate 13 and arranging the pulling convex patterns 17 on the surface of the pulling button piece 16, so that the operation is more convenient, the hand is not easy to slip due to the arrangement of the pulling convex patterns 17, and the operation is flexible.
In the utility model, a connecting shaft lever 18 is fixedly arranged on one side surface of the support sleeve 1 far away from the end bearing pad 10, a handle shaft 19 is fixedly arranged on the end part of the connecting shaft lever 18, and a handle sleeve 20 is sleeved on the surface of the handle shaft 19. The connecting shaft rod 18 and the handle shaft 19 are arranged, so that the hand holding is convenient for operation during drilling operation.
In the present invention, the handle sheath 20 is made of silica gel, and the number of the connecting shaft rods 18 is two. Through the handle cover 20 that sets up the silica gel material for gripping is difficult for the slippage in the operation process, and makes the hand more comfortable.
In the utility model, the surface of the hand-held rotary column 9 is provided with an anti-skid groove 21, and the anti-skid groove 21 is a rectangular groove. Through setting up the surface of anti-skidding groove 21 at handheld rotary column 9 for dial to handheld rotary column 9 is difficult for the slip mistake during the operation, has increased frictional action and damping coefficient.
In the utility model, the support sleeve 1 and the sliding bush 4 are both rectangular frame structures, and the left side of the sliding bush 4 is in a through shape. Through setting up rectangular support cover 1 and sliding bush 4 sliding connection, provided and avoided pivoted limiting displacement.
In conclusion, according to the automobile luggage rack end drilling tool, the two clamping press plates 13 are clamped on the end of a rack body to be processed through the clamping contact pads 14 by pulling the clamping press plates 13, the clamping contact pads 14 are clamped more tightly through the damping grooves 15, the threaded rotating shaft 6 can be driven to rotate by twisting the handheld rotating column 9, so that the internal threaded pipe 5 transversely moves on the surface of the internal threaded pipe, the sliding bush 4 and the limiting sliding piece 3 are driven to slide, the two clamping support arms 11 are pushed or pulled to move, the clamped rack body end can be pressed against the end bearing pad 10 on the side wall of the support sleeve 1, the effect of multi-directional stress of a clamped workpiece is achieved, the aim of supporting the end of the clamping rack body conveniently is achieved, the automobile luggage rack end drilling tool is more convenient to be suitable for drilling operation of the end of a structure, stable support is provided for the automobile luggage rack, and the problem that most of the existing clamping devices on the market only clamp the two opposite surfaces is solved, the end part of the luggage rack is difficult to clamp and use in a targeted way, and the end part drilling operation of the automobile luggage rack is difficult to flexibly support and assist.
